Nature, God and Love

Somehow, I feel nature, love and God are interconnected. When I see the beautiful snowcapped mountains, the vast boundless seas and oceans, the sweet songs of cuckoos, the chirping of birds, the beauty of the rising sun, the blooming flowers spreading its fragrance all around, the lovely vast beaches, the greenery on either side of the flowing rivers, the ponds filled with lotus and lilies, my heart fills with glee, and at that moment, I forget all my miseries, sorrows, guilt, aims, goals and the material world.

I can feel the surge of emotions encompassing me and I let myself drown in the blissful sweetness of nature. My eyes widen involuntarily in wondrous amazement. I can sense the presence of God in the caress of the gentle breeze, the heady smell of flowers, the touch of the frothy waves on my feet, the buzz of the bees, the sweetness of the nectar, the thin screen of early morning fog, the soft sting of the rain drops, the colours on the rainbow, and much more. The sensation cannot be expressed in words. Is this the Omnipresence of the Omnipotent? Oh! Yes, it is. The feeling goes deep down within me and awakens my inner consciousness. My mind stops thinking and I can feel calmness encircle me. That feels like heaven.

Slowly when I come out of the reverie, I am overwhelmed by the love of God. The boundless flow of love sweeps me along with it. What a beautiful feeling? It is an amazing realization. I become one with God. I can feel the power of God. Now, I am fully aware of myself. I think about all the bloodshed and holy wars carried out in the name of this ever loving God. There is so much of hatred, intolerance, terrorism and violence in this world, legalized in the name of God. When will people understand this? When will they learn to live in peace? These things have to be understood by people and are very difficult to profess. Love is God and God is love. So, with love you can accomplish anything you want in life. Go, conquer the world with love.
